索引是一种用于加快数据检索速度的技术。它允许系统快速找到存储在数据库中的特定数据项,从而减少了查询时间。索引通常由一个包含键值对的表组成,该表存储在磁盘上,并与实际存储在数据库中的数据进行关联。在数据库管理系统中,索引可以用于多种目的。其中一种常见的用途是实现快速搜索和检索功能。当用户执行搜索操作时,系统会先检查索引表以确定是否存在与搜索条件匹配的记录。如果存在匹配记录,则系统会立即返回结果;否则,系统将遍历整个数据库来找到匹配项。除了提高查询效率之外,索引还可以用于防止数据冗余和错误。通过使用索引,可以确保只有需要的数据项被存储在数据库中,并且可以快速访问它们。这样可以减少磁盘空间占用,并提高系统性能。另外,在某些情况下,索引还可以用于备份和恢复数据库。当备份整个数据库时,也可以备份索引表以确保能够轻松恢复特定记录。总之,索引是一种非常有用的技术,可以在数据库系统中用于加快数据检索速度、防止数据冗余和错误,并且还可以用于备份和恢复数据库。通过使用索引,我们可以提高系统性能并改善用户体验。
Copyright © 2025 IZhiDa.com All Rights Reserved.
知答 版权所有 粤ICP备2023042255号